Our College supports excellence in teaching and would like to foster professional development and support for our graduate teaching assistants.
To this end, the Cardon Academy for Teaching Excellence is excited to offer small 'learning communities' in which facilitated discussions will help graduate teaching assistants gain new skills, learn from peers and teaching mentors, and explore the ways in which teaching enhances our professional trajectories.
These discussions are optional and will last for one hour every two weeks. They are open to all graduate students.
